Handover Note — Director Transition, Operations Division

For the incoming director: the hiring freeze in the Oslett division remains in effect pending the board's capital review. Fourteen requisitions are paused; two backfills were granted exceptions on criticality grounds. Please maintain weekly updates to the board and avoid signalling any timeline externally. Context on the rationale follows below, and it must remain restricted.

internal memo for fajog-yagaf: Gross margin on Ulaael came in at 20 percent against a plan of 10 percent. Only 9 of the 80 pilot accounts renewed Ulaael, so a churn review is set for July 1.

**Action item PM-2218-04 (owner: platform-docs team)**

During the Hollowfen incident, responders couldn't edit the outage status page because wiki write access was restricted to the Burrowlight admin role, and no admin was on shift. We will add an "incident-responder" role with scoped write access to the /status and /runbooks spaces, granted automatically to the active on-call rotation. Reviewers should check the role mapping change against the access matrix documented on the internal page that follows.

runbook for yajog-tahag: https://jira.norvasys.corp/spaces/job/display/ca5ff3fa4d4d

/*
 * Client setup for the Stagewright seat-map renderer.
 * The renderer fetches hall layouts for the Pellamy Theatre
 * from the internal venue-geometry service. If seat blocks
 * render empty, check that this client initialized before
 * the cache warmer. The service authenticates with the
 * key on the following line.
 */

service key, bajep-hahig: zpat15_8GdlyV2kd9BCqYH